So I was visiting home over the weekend and my older brother asked me if there were any more good games on Wii. I said I had heard that No More Heroes and Okami were good although Okami was apparently better on PS2; I left the PS2 back at my apartment so he decided to pick it up for Wii anyway. I was bleeding testosterone after I finished Contra IV on normal mode in a glorious eight-hour marathon, so I figured I'd play something more relaxing and put Okami in rather than the hyperviolent No More Heroes.

Earlier that day I watched as my brother sat through about forty minutes of introduction (MGS4 am cry) and decided to skip all that. My first impression was that this game looks fucking incredible; I know the Wii version is supposed to have some inferior paper filter effect or something like that, but that first area totally wowed me and although the remote's D-pad made for an awkwardly positioned camera I made full use of it. My second impression -- and one that continued to grow for the next three hours -- is that this Issun is fucking annoying, worse even than Navi in Ocarina of Time: "Hey Amaterasu, look at the SPHERE this bear is standing on; you've figured it out already, but doesn't it look exactly like the SPHERE in that PAINTING? I bet if you moved this into the ROOM with the SAPLING, something amazing will happen!" The game continues to insult my intelligence: five seconds and one hallway later, Issun again interrupts play and the camera pans BACK to the painting as if everything weren't obvious enough already. I used to babysit my little sister all the time and Blues Clues does the exact same thing as the host, Steve, says, "Hmm...I wonder what would happen if we put THIS over THERE!"; that's all well and good but I'm not five years old anymore.

Oh, and my third impression is just as bad but my contention is squarely with the system. I guess the waggle didn't turn me off too much since the combat was simple enough anyway, but then I started training with that old guy in his dojo and had to learn some technique where I waggle for four consecutive strikes. It took me about a half hour to finally pull that shit off; I couldn't find out why it wasn't working at first and eventually I just resigned myself to laying on the floor and randomly waggling until it finally worked (with no apparent difference in input).

Overall though I'm impressed with nothing but Okami's appearance; some of you told me that this is better than Wind Waker, but so far I think I like it less than even Twilight Princess. Does Okami get much better (I just learned to draw cherry bombs, btw) or did my own issues with the gameplay not bother the rest of you?
